What we were working with

An eighteen-riser climb from the sidewalk with uneven treads, no handrail and eroding beds on both sides.

What we built

We poured a new stair run with consistent risers and a code handrail, faced the cheek walls in stone, and terraced the planting either side so the beds stop washing onto the treads.

How it turned out

A safe, handsome climb — and a frontage that no longer sheds soil onto the sidewalk.
